There was only one small issue on the morning of the wedding which was quickly rectified. The showers and sink taps up at the Borgo apartments and bridal suite weren’t working on for an hour or so as there was no water pressure meaning there was a bit of a rush in the morning to get the bridal party ready for the arrival of the hair and makeup team but thankfully the issue was resolved fairly quickly and didn’t impact the day. I would also say to brides to make sure you have someone dedicated to collecting special keepsake items on the wedding day for you as sadly we left some items behind. We were in a rush to check out and waited a while on the golf buggy to collect us from the bridal suite upon check out with the bus to Rome waiting on us checking out to depart. I quickly searched the lost and found property box (a great idea and a very handy thing to have at the reception area!) but could not find anything other than a pair of sunglasses so we presumed our items had been handed to a friend or relative but later discovered they had not. We emailed Borgo on the Saturday, 2 days after checking out and were told that they no longer had my bridal bouquet or our maid of honours bouquet which were artificial and we had planned to reuse for our legal wedding back home in Glasgow. This was unfortunate so definitely ensure you check out in plenty of time and have a list of everything that is important to you that you’d like kept.

   Read moreWas in BdT for wedding celebrations over 3 days. It's a nice, secluded accommodation/venue as it's an old village that's out of the hustle and bustle of Rome City. It's a rustic, little town that is split between 3 areas - old Borgo (uphill), the pool/restaurant & accommodation area with the mini bar/restaurant 'La Favole'. If you manage to fill all the rooms, this place is fabulous to host guests as it feels like it's very much 'your own'.
Bear in mind that we were in this venue for a wedding. We were staying uphill and we had problems with lack of running water, for approximately 2 hours, for the first 2 days; not what you needed before the welcome dinner party or the wedding day.
There also seemed to be mixed information between hotel staff and the event coordinators, sometimes it seemed like information was not shared between staff.
Also, worth noting that the event coordinators finished early on non-wedding days and started their shift late on the wedding day. There was an issue with the buses on the guests day of arrival and we weren't aware of this until guests reached out as the buses were not where they said it was going to be; there is an extra cost (we weren't made aware of this) if the buses don't leave in time. Reception staff were available to lend us a hand but this was stressful and meant we missed wedding rehearsal as there was quite a delay with guests before the BBQ dinner.
We decided not to use the recommended vendors and opted to go for our own; which meant we ended up coordinating between our chosen vendors and hotel staff during the welcome BBQ dinner and the morning of the wedding day. During planning, you fill out all the spreadsheets that they send however we were made aware that they didn't even attempt to contact vendors that we've chosen outside of their recommended vendors.
